Output 21d911e202d59725025a140101d68e3d43f7fd840e239b83e20886afaedc332a:5

value
28963
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 06b752b7a375783a22dfc6ae431020055b347e6a OP_EQUALVERIFY OP_CHECKSIG
address
1cWffXfgZumPvJfbwpsYKXzdcU46t6Eib
transaction
21d911e202d59725025a140101d68e3d43f7fd840e239b83e20886afaedc332a
confirmations
173000
spent
true